Magnolia Highlights Target’s Summer Products Rollout

Target is giving its guests a host of new outdoor products from which to choose, with key private labels leading the way.

Target is putting some spring into its summer home goods assortment with the rollout of a plethora of home products sold under several of its private brands.

Highlighting the list is the retailer’s Hearth & Hand with Magnolia collection from HGTV stars Chip and Joanna Gaines. A review of the latest products on Target.com found 125 items for use around the home. The collection is priced from $1.99 for a 14-count pack of paper beverage napkins to $499.99 for a 2-pack of cushioned wood outdoor club chairs.

A large percentage of the Magnolia additions are focused on outdoor entertaining and include dinnerware, serveware, furniture and home accessories.

Launched in 2017, Magnolia has been a hallmark collection for Target. The retailer has made the line a centerpiece of its home assortment in store and online, which is kept fresh by the seasonal turnover of products.

Target’s proprietary Threshold with Studio McGee collection has also been expanded. Similar to Magnolia, Threshold consists of a host of products that range from an outdoor rug collection priced from $20 to $200 to an outdoor tableware collection that includes dinnerware, serveware and furniture priced from $10 to $388.

The colorful Sun Squad collection has also been expanded and now features more than 100 items for use around the home and at the beach during the warm summer months. A majority of items are priced less than $25 and include folding chairs and chaise lounges, drinkware, serveware and items for use in the garden.
